摘要
Syntheses of no carrier added (n.c.a.) 6-fluoro-1,4-dihydro-1-cyclopropyl-4-oxo-7-[4-[F-18]fluoro-phenacyl-1-piperacinyl]-chinolincarboxylic acid ([F-18]COPCA) and n.c.a. 4-[F-18]fluoro-benzoyl-ubiquicidin 29-41 ([F-18]UBI 29-41) are described. [18F]COPCA was synthesised within 120 min with a radiochemical yield of 9-12%. [F-18]UBI 29-41 was synthesised within 150 min with a radiochemical yield of 15-20%. Both compounds had a specific activity of more than 35 GBq/mu mol. The biological activity was verified by measuring its binding to Staphylococcus aureus bacteria. Specific binding was found for [F-18]UBI 29-41 (12-17%), whereas no specific binding for [F-18]COPCA was found. (c) 2006 Elsevier Ltd. All rights reserved.
